  • Abstract
    In this paper, we propose an office layout plan evaluation system using evacuation simulation with communication among agents. The proposed system evaluates office layout plans generated by the office layout support system using genetic algorithm. This office layout support system can generate layout plans which satisfy some conditions given by users. However, the flow of office workers can not considered in the system. In the proposed system, the office layout plan generated by the office layout support system using genetic algorithm and the conditions for agents are given, and then the agents move under the conditions. Based on the behavior of agents, the evaluation on the maximum time for escape, average speed, the number of agents who could not reach entrance and so on are carried out. We carried out a series of computer experiments in order to demonstrate the effectiveness of the proposed system and confirmed that the proposed system can evaluate layout plans.
